Output e68b0a689ca132dd36ffc2d9b62339b37562bc955017f430a99ed185b47fa22f:3

value
9341768
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49f0fcd5b058c626f93fe1a4991402e5671dcf62c689d8a62ad560ca7865f797
address
tb1pf8c0e4dstrrzd7fluxjfj9qzu4n3mnmzc6ya3f3264sv57r977tsjj4qc3
transaction
e68b0a689ca132dd36ffc2d9b62339b37562bc955017f430a99ed185b47fa22f
confirmations
71436
spent
true